About Arjunbera Village

Arjunbera is a village in Gurbandha tehsil in district of Purbi Singhbhum, Jharkhand, India. As per the data provided by Census of India in 2011, total population of Arjunbera was 840 which includes 432 males and 408 females. Arjunbera covers 619 ha area. Pincode of Arjunbera is 832101.
